Configuration mishap: Sensitive data from BMW was apparently freely accessible on the Internet
A BMW cloud storage server was configured so that anyone could access the stored data – including access data and secret keys. (Data leak, Microsoft) Go to Source
Concept vehicle: Chrysler Halcyon is said to be the electric sports car of the future
Chrysler has introduced the Halcyon, an electric sports car that can charge wirelessly and drive autonomously. (Electric car, automobile) Go to Source
Redesign: Tesla is said to have postponed the Model Y facelift to 2025
Tesla has reportedly postponed its planned Model Y redesign until 2025. The electric car, codenamed Juniper, was expected in 2024. (Tesla, Electric car) Go to Source
Electric car: Mini Cooper E travels around 300 km on one charge
With the Mini Cooper E in Classic trim, BMW has introduced an entry-level model that can travel around 305 kilometers on a single battery charge. (BMW, Electric car) Go to Source
Model S and Model X: Tesla revises controversial control horn
Tesla has introduced a revised version of its controversial control horn for the Model S and X, thereby fixing a major problem. (Tesla Model S, Electric car) Go to Source
German Handelsblatt: Car supplier: Continental is cutting another 1,750 jobs in the car division – new area affected for the first time008482
The job cuts that have now been announced come in addition to 5,400 jobs that will be lost in administration. Like Bosch and ZF, Continental is now saving money on research and development. Go to Source

German Handelsblatt: Mercedes HR Director: “The educational level of our applicants for training is declining”008481
Sabine Kohleisen feels an increasing lack of education. The Mercedes HR director expects improvement from the “Future Mission Education” initiative – and is making an appeal to companies. Go to Source
German Handelsblatt: Car imports: Around 13,000 Volkswagen cars are stuck in US ports008480
Components that violate US law against forced labor have been found in Porsche, Bentley and Audi vehicles. The parts are already being replaced. Go to Source
